Error message 'Could not calculate route' when one is shown on the map #bug
-
Steps to reproduce:
- Open the app
- Select MRA RoutePlanner
- Select Search icon
- Select Favourites
- Select a favourite
- Select 'Add to route' (to add as point 1)
- Select Search icon
- Select Favourites
- Select a another favourite (different to the first one)
- Select 'Add to route' (to add as point 2)
A route is calculated at this point and shown on the map.
- Scroll down and select Navigate
The error message is displayed and Navigation does not start:

If you go back to 'Route information', enter a route name and save it, Navigation can then start OK. It seems as though a route must have a name before Navigation can start. If that is by design, then a better message would be helpful.
